Avoiding excessive use of antacids is one way of preventing metabolic alkalosis. Metabolic alkalosis occurs when the blood becomes too alkaline with a pH above 7.45, often due to a primary bicarbonate excess. This condition can arise from ingestion of excessive amounts of bicarbonate, citrate, or antacids, particularly by individuals dealing with persistent heartburn or an ulcer. Chronic metabolic alkalosis can be caused by conditions like Cushing's disease or through certain habits and treatments such as the loss of hydrochloric acid from prolonged vomiting, potassium depletion from diuretic use, or excessive laxative consumption. These instances lead to a transient excess of bicarbonate in the bloodstream.
